Mammograms Find Tiny Tumors But Are They Deadly?

A new study adds to the confusing questions about mammograms and how many lives they save.
It found that while mammograms do indeed find breast tumors when they are very small and presumably the easiest to treat, widespread breast cancer screening doesn't necessarily lower the overall death rate from breast cancer or even cut back on the number of biggest breast tumors found later.
"We found that counties with the most screening had substantially more breast cancers being diagnosed," said Charles Harding, a Seattle data analyst who worked with a team at Harvard and Dartmouth universities on the study.

Pro Mammogram advocates scramble to discredit and shut down study findings

The pro mammogram industry is scrambling to shut this study down and get women back to "Business and Usual":

Twenty five year follow-up for breast cancer incidence and mortality of the Canadian National Breast Screening Study: randomised screening trial

BMJ 2014; 348 doi: http://dx.doi.org/10.1136/bmj.g366 (Published 11 February 2014)
Cite this as: BMJ 2014;348:g366
Conclusion Annual mammography in women aged 40-59 does not reduce mortality from breast cancer beyond that of physical examination or usual care when adjuvant therapy for breast cancer is freely available. Overall, 22% (106/484) of screen detected invasive breast cancers were over-diagnosed, representing one over-diagnosed breast cancer for every 424 women who received mammography screening in the trial.

The conclusions of the researchers are not good for the breast screening industry: Mammograms are no more effective than physical examinations and there is over-diagnosis and consequent over-treatment of those undergoing mammograms.

    A Closer Look at Screening Mammography
    Dr Laura Esserman of the University of California startled the medical community with an article questioning screening mammography published in the Journal of the American Medical Association (JAMA ).  Dr Laura Esserman reviewed 20 years of breast cancer data.  Her conclusion is not favorable:
    "Mammography screening for breast cancer has significant drawbacks, and expected survival benefits have not materialized. "
    "While the incidence of early stage breast cancer has decreased due to mammography, the incidence rates for the killer cancers, (the advanced cancers) have remained stable.  While it is true that overall mortality rates have declined slightly, this is attributed to better treatment rather than increased detection."
    Dr Laura Esserman.
    Let's take a look at the Data Charts Dr Esserman used for her JAMA Article. ( Below Image Courtesy of Rethinking Screening for Breast Cancer and Prostate Cancer Laura Esserman, MD, JAMA. 2009;302(15):1685-1692.)
    Breast Cancer Data Laura Esserman Jama
    The above chart shows the critical information in Dr Esserman's JAMA article.  The Pink line is TOTAL breast cancer incidence annually.  Note increase beginning in 1983 with introduction of mammography screening.  Below the pink line, we see three more lines: this is the breakdown of the total incidence into localized, regional and metastatic cases.  The turquoise line is localized cancer. The light purple line is regional cancer and the black line (lowest) is metastatic cancer.  The killer cancers are the regional and metastatic cases.  Note that these numbers have remained stable with little change in spite of detection of massive numbers of localized cases
